The Foundation: Understanding Virtual Dual Display

At its core, a virtual dual display is a software-created secondary monitor that exists entirely within your computer's operating system. Unlike a traditional multi-monitor setup, which requires at least one additional physical screen, a video output port, and connecting cables, a virtual display is generated by a dedicated application or built-in operating system features. This virtual screen is then rendered either within a window on your main desktop or, more powerfully, as a bona fide extension of your desktop environment.

Your computer's operating system, whether it's Windows, macOS, or Linux, is designed to manage multiple displays. It assigns each screen a coordinate in a broader digital coordinate system. A virtual display driver cleverly inserts itself into this system, telling the OS that a new "hardware" display is present. The OS happily sends graphical data to this virtual driver, which then handles where and how that visual information is presented—either in a resizable window or as a seemingly genuine second screen that your mouse cursor can glide into.

Under the Hood: The Technology That Powers Virtual Displays

The magic of virtual dual displays is enabled by a piece of software called a virtual display driver. This driver acts as a translator between your operating system's graphics subsystem and the application managing the virtual screen.

  1. Driver Installation: The virtual display software installs a driver that emulates a physical graphics adapter.
  2. OS Recognition: Your operating system detects this new "adapter" and treats it as it would a newly connected HDMI or DisplayPort monitor.
  3. Desktop Extension: You then use your system's standard display settings (e.g., Windows Settings or macOS System Preferences) to extend your desktop onto this new virtual display.
  4. Rendering: The OS directs the graphical output for the second desktop to the virtual driver. The driver then pipes this visual data to the parent application, which renders it for you to see and interact with.

Modern implementations are remarkably efficient. While they do consume some system resources (CPU and GPU cycles, and a portion of your video RAM), the impact on performance is minimal for most tasks on contemporary computers. The software intelligently manages the rendering to ensure a smooth experience.

Setting Up Your Own Virtual Workspace

Implementing a virtual dual display is typically a straightforward process. Most solutions involve a simple download and installation. Once the software is installed, you will likely find a new icon in your system tray or menu bar. Opening this will give you control over your virtual displays. The key steps usually involve:

  1. Opening your system's native display settings.
  2. Identifying the new virtual display that has appeared.
  3. Selecting the option to "Extend these displays."
  4. Arranging the virtual display's position relative to your physical monitor (e.g., to the left, right, top, or bottom).

From there, you can simply drag and drop applications and windows onto your new digital canvas. It behaves exactly like a physical monitor. For optimal use, consider using keyboard shortcuts or window management tools to quickly snap windows to the edges of either screen, further enhancing your efficiency.

Navigating the Limitations and Considerations

No technology is perfect, and virtual displays come with a few caveats to consider. The most notable is a performance impact. Rendering an additional desktop requires computational power. For basic office tasks, this is negligible. However, for GPU-intensive activities like high-end gaming or 3D rendering, the slight overhead might be noticeable on older systems. You cannot physically touch or directly interact with the virtual screen in the same way; it exists purely in software. Furthermore, while the technology is stable, it relies on software drivers that must be kept updated to remain compatible with operating system updates. Despite these minor considerations, the trade-off for a free, portable, and instantly available second screen is overwhelmingly positive for the vast majority of users.
